From a5ebdafb8218e8071f3381c0adf436b21fddabbf Mon Sep 17 00:00:00 2001 From: Dave Page Date: Mon, 25 Mar 2019 07:50:55 -0400 Subject: [PATCH] Enlarge the grab handles for resizing dialogs etc. Fixes #4063 --- docs/en_US/release_notes_4_4.rst | 1 + web/package.json | 2 +- .../static/scss/_webcabin.pgadmin.scss | 39 +++++++++++++------ web/yarn.lock | 4 +- 4 files changed, 32 insertions(+), 14 deletions(-) diff --git a/docs/en_US/release_notes_4_4.rst b/docs/en_US/release_notes_4_4.rst index 895f7e206..1d97e5617 100644 --- a/docs/en_US/release_notes_4_4.rst +++ b/docs/en_US/release_notes_4_4.rst @@ -49,6 +49,7 @@ Bug fixes | `Bug #4054 `_ - Handle resultsets with zero columns correctly in the Query Tool. | `Bug #4060 `_ - Fix the latexpdf doc build. | `Bug #4062 `_ - Fix handling of numeric arrays in View/Edit Data. +| `Bug #4063 `_ - Enlarge the grab handles for resizing dialogs etc. | `Bug #4069 `_ - Append the file suffix to filenames when needed in the File Create dialogue. | `Bug #4071 `_ - Ensure that Firefox prompts for a filename/location when downloading query results as a CSV file. | `Bug #4073 `_ - Change the CodeMirror active line background colour to $color-danger-lighter so it doesn't conflict with the selection colour. diff --git a/web/package.json b/web/package.json index 822ec4512..e6424f4fc 100644 --- a/web/package.json +++ b/web/package.json @@ -90,7 +90,7 @@ "underscore": "^1.9.1", "underscore.string": "^3.3.5", "watchify": "~3.11.1", - "webcabin-docker": "git+https://github.com/EnterpriseDB/wcDocker/#a002c706ca34ee20772091b04a6cb05b13548cdc", + "webcabin-docker": "git+https://github.com/EnterpriseDB/wcDocker/#32b58375ac57c8b7c681a64fea226ce306dee33a", "wkx": "^0.4.6" }, "scripts": { diff --git a/web/pgadmin/static/scss/_webcabin.pgadmin.scss b/web/pgadmin/static/scss/_webcabin.pgadmin.scss index 35b5e6774..543336d2b 100644 --- a/web/pgadmin/static/scss/_webcabin.pgadmin.scss +++ b/web/pgadmin/static/scss/_webcabin.pgadmin.scss @@ -102,8 +102,8 @@ & .wcFrameCornerNW, & .wcFrameCornerSE, & .wcFrameCornerSW { - height: $card-border-radius*2; - width: $card-border-radius*2; + height: $splitter-hover-width; + width: $splitter-hover-width; background: transparent; } @@ -139,12 +139,12 @@ border-bottom-left-radius: $card-border-radius; } - .wcFrameEdgeH { + .wcFrameEdgeN, .wcFrameEdgeS { left: $card-border-radius !important; right: $card-border-radius !important; } - .wcFrameEdgeV { + .wcFrameEdgeW, .wcFrameEdgeE { top: $card-border-radius !important; bottom: $card-border-radius !important; } @@ -186,24 +186,41 @@ } .wcFrameEdge { - background-color: $panel-border-color; + background-color: transparent; border: none; + z-index: 5; } -.wcFrameEdgeH { - height: $panel-border-width; +.wcFrameEdgeN, .wcFrameEdgeS { + height: $splitter-hover-width/2 + 1; } -.wcFrameEdgeV { - width: $panel-border-width; +.wcFrameEdgeN { + border-top: $panel-border; +} + +.wcFrameEdgeS { + border-bottom: $panel-border; +} + +.wcFrameEdgeW, .wcFrameEdgeE { + width: $splitter-hover-width/2 + 1; +} + +.wcFrameEdgeW { + border-left: $panel-border; +} + +.wcFrameEdgeE { + border-right: $panel-border; } .wcFrameCornerNW, .wcFrameCornerNE, .wcFrameCornerSW, .wcFrameCornerSE { - height: $panel-border-width; - width: $panel-border-width; + height: $splitter-hover-width; + width: $splitter-hover-width; } diff --git a/web/yarn.lock b/web/yarn.lock index b0e79c8f1..d6125dc8e 100644 --- a/web/yarn.lock +++ b/web/yarn.lock @@ -9015,9 +9015,9 @@ watchpack@^1.5.0: graceful-fs "^4.1.2" neo-async "^2.5.0" -"webcabin-docker@git+https://github.com/EnterpriseDB/wcDocker/#a002c706ca34ee20772091b04a6cb05b13548cdc": +"webcabin-docker@git+https://github.com/EnterpriseDB/wcDocker/#32b58375ac57c8b7c681a64fea226ce306dee33a": version "2.2.4-dev" - resolved "git+https://github.com/EnterpriseDB/wcDocker/#a002c706ca34ee20772091b04a6cb05b13548cdc" + resolved "git+https://github.com/EnterpriseDB/wcDocker/#32b58375ac57c8b7c681a64fea226ce306dee33a" dependencies: FileSaver "^0.10.0" font-awesome "^4.7.0"